General procedure: IV, e.g. bromo-substituted 3H-1,3-benzoxazol-2-one, (1 eq.) was suspended in a 1:1 toluene/EtOH mixture (10 mL per mmol IV). The boronic acid V (1.5 eq.) was added followed by aq. NaCO3 (2 M, 0.55 mL per mmcl IV, 1.1 eq.). The resulting suspension was degassed undernitrogen for 10 mm, followed by addition of Pd(PPh3)4 (0.1 eq.) and heating under microwave irradiation at 100 C for 30 mm. The reaction mixture was diluted with EtOAc (40 mL per mmcl IV), and water (40 mL per mmcl IV) was added. The two phases were separated and the aqueous layer was extracted with EtOAc (2 x 40 mL per mmcl IV). The combined organic phases were dried over Na2SO4, evaporated on silica, and the compound was purified by column chromatography using the Teledyne ISCO apparatus (cyclohexane:EtOAc).The title compound was obtained according to the General Procedure II, starting from 6-bromobenzoxazolone (500 mg, 2.34 mmol) and (4-fluorophenyl)boronic acid (490 mg, 3.50mmol). White solid (450 mg, 42%). 1H NMR (400 MHz, CDCI,) 6 7.08 (m, 3H), 7.33 (dd, J = 8.1, 1.6 Hz, 1H), 7.39 (d, J = 1.4 Hz, 1H), 7.47 -7.52 (m, 2H), 7.91 (s, 1H). MS (ESI) m/z: 228 [M-H]., 19932-85-5
